what is the 10th percentile of the standard normal distribution? -1.28 1.28 0.9 -0.90

Explanation:

Step1: Recall the definition of percentile in standard normal distribution

The \(p\) - th percentile of a standard normal distribution \(Z\sim N(0,1)\) is a value \(z_p\) such that \(P(Z\leq z_p)=p/100\).
For the \(10^{th}\) percentile, we want to find \(z\) such that \(P(Z\leq z) = 0.10\).

Step2: Use the standard normal table (z - table)

Looking up the value in the standard normal table (the cumulative distribution function of the standard normal distribution \(\varPhi(z)=P(Z\leq z)\)).
We know that \(\varPhi(- 1.28)\approx0.1003\) and \(\varPhi(-0.90)\approx0.1841\).

Answer:

-1.28
